Verdict

ESCALATING was a beaten favourite last time when strongly fancied to follow up a Southwell success for Mick Appleby. He was noted putting in some good work at the finish having encountered trouble in running and then being forced to come wide into the straight. He can go one better here at the expense of former stable companion Bouclier who may the 6lb penalty asking a little too much. Sophisticated Heir is usually thereabouts and, with an in form 5lb claimer on board, he looks sure to be thereabouts again.
